Cutting Through the Spec Sheet Jungle

Manufacturers love throwing jargon around. Let's decode what actually affects your laundry life:

Capacity Isn't Just a Number Game

That "5.2 cu ft" label? Misleading. I tested this with my king-size comforter. My old 4.8 cu ft top-loader couldn't handle it, but a 4.5 cu ft front-loader from LG did. Why? Drum design matters more than raw size. For a family of four, you'll want at least 4.5 cu ft. Singles or couples can get by with 3.8-4.2 cu ft.

Household SizeMinimum Washer CapacityDryer Capacity Tip
1-2 people3.8-4.2 cu ftMatch washer size exactly
3-4 people4.5-4.8 cu ftAdd 0.5-1 cu ft larger than washer
5+ people5.0+ cu ftMust be 1-1.5 cu ft larger than washer

Dryer capacity should always exceed washer capacity. Wet clothes fluff up. I ignored this once and ended up doing two dry cycles for every wash - my electric bill screamed.

The Front-Load vs Top-Load Smackdown

Front-loaders aren't perfect despite what influencers say. Yeah, they're gentler on clothes and use less water. But bending down kills my back, and if you forget to wipe the gasket? Hello, mold city. Top-loaders without agitators (those pole things) are better now. My Samsung top-loader cleans workout clothes just fine without shredding them.

  • Front-loader pros: Better cleaning (especially stains), water efficiency, stackable
  • Top-loader pros: No bending, faster cycles, lower upfront cost

Features That Actually Help vs Gimmicks

Through trial and error, here's what proved useful:

  • Steam function: Surprisingly great for sanitizing kid's germs or removing wrinkles (cuts my ironing time)
  • Smart diagnostics: Saved me $200 when my dryer error coded and told me it was a $15 sensor
  • Delay start: Fill at night, run at 7AM when electricity rates drop

Skip the "app control" unless you love phone notifications about rinse cycles. And that "allergen cycle"? Mostly rebranded sanitize settings.

Installation Landmines They Don't Tell You About

I learned these lessons painfully installing 7 units:

⚡ Voltage reality: Electric dryers need 240V outlets. If you're switching from gas, hiring an electrician adds $300-600. Gas dryers cost less to run but require hookups.

  • Venting nightmares: That flexible foil duct? Fire hazard. Rigid metal ducts perform better but need precise measurements.
  • Floor slope: Washers vibrate violently if floors aren't level. Use shim kits ($5 at hardware stores).
  • Stacking requirements : Many front-loaders need $50-$70 stacking kits. Check before buying!

Maintenance: Skip This and Pay the Price

Top rated washers and dryers die early without simple care:

Washer TLC

  • Monthly cleaner tabs ($5) prevent mold
  • Leave door/drawer ajar after cycles
  • Clean filter every 3 months (usually bottom left)

Dryer Danger Zones

Lint causes 15,000 fires yearly:

  • Clean lint trap EVERY load
  • Professional duct cleaning every 2 years ($150)
  • Check exterior vent flap isn't stuck

My dryer repair guy showed me photos of vents packed solid like insulation. Terrifying.

When Things Go Wrong: Troubleshooting Top Rated Washers and Dryers

Before calling the $150/hour technician:

SymptomLikely CulpritDIY Fix Attempt
Washer won't spinUnbalanced loadRedistribute clothes, restart
Dryer heats but takes foreverClogged vent ductDisconnect duct, vacuum from both ends
Water leaks underneathLoose drain hoseCheck connections behind machine
Loud banging during spinShock absorbers wornYouTube tutorial + $30 parts

For error codes, Google your model number + code. Appliance repair forums save fortunes.

Questions I Get Asked Constantly About Top Rated Washers and Dryers

Are extended warranties worth it?

Rarely. Most top rated washers and dryers break just after warranties expire. Better to set aside $300 for future repairs. Exceptions: Speed Queen's 7-year coverage includes labor.

Do steam functions really work?

Surprisingly yes - on wrinkles and odors. Less convinced on stain removal. My ketchup test showed minimal difference versus hot water.

How long should these actually last?

Disappointing truth: 8-12 years for most brands. Speed Queen and commercial Maytags hit 15+. Old machines lasting 25 years? Myth. They used more water/electricity than your car.

Is stacking safe with kids/pets?

Modern stacking kits lock securely. But anchor them to the wall. My cousin's cat knocked over an unsecured set. Totaled.

The Hidden Costs That Sneak Up On You

That $799 washer might actually cost $1,200:

  • Delivery/haul-away fees ($75-$150)
  • Hookup kits (hoses, ducts, cords) - another $50-$120
  • Electrical/gas modifications ($300-$600 if needed)
  • Stacking kits ($50-$140)

Always ask retailers for package deals including installation. Lowe's gave me free delivery when I bought both units.
